Output d8d886215a6728d4aaaf9d91b4628959c5b5a63a1ac02a00da61e51b8c7de126:0

value
422424
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3080808a7565035a66d954d7766b75b297a9d060 OP_EQUALVERIFY OP_CHECKSIG
address
15RTNh688sojRmspa6uRJF6ceghPdEFYvE
transaction
d8d886215a6728d4aaaf9d91b4628959c5b5a63a1ac02a00da61e51b8c7de126
spent
true